Acid House: Among the earliest types of house, acid house is known for its squelchy, copyright basslines designed utilizing the Roland TB-303 synthesizer. Its repetitive beats and hypnotic rhythms performed a pivotal function in the UK’s late ’80s rave scene.
1st originating as “Hello-NRG” music, acid house is characterised via the squelching sounds and basslines on the Roland TB-303. Sleezy D’s “I’ve Missing Manage” is called one of many earliest recordings of acid house:

Because of the lack of accredited, authorized dance party venues, house music promoters started organising illegal functions in unused warehouses, aeroplane hangars, and while in the countryside. The Legal Justice and General public Buy Act 1994 was a federal government attempt to ban massive rave dance situations showcasing music with "repetitive beats", as a consequence of regulation enforcement allegations that these events were being linked to illegal club medication.
